Ode
poetry [ ]
(in Sapphic metre)

- -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- -
by [Mihai_Eminescu ]

2005-10-22  |     |  Submited by Constantin Enianu





That I’m doomed to die I believed it never;
Always young and clad in my mantle wandered,
Dreaming eyes uplifted for ever fixed on
Solitude’s starlight.

When so sudden, there on my pathway rising,
Sorrow, O so painfully sweet, thou comest !
Then with deep delight to the dregs I drank thy
Merciless death cup.

And like Nessus burning alive and tortured,
Poisoned as was Hercules with his garment
This great fire that’s blazing in me I cannot
Quench with an ocean.

My own dream consuming me, sore lamenting,
On my pyre I die thus to ashes burning…
Can I from it living arise as bringht as
Phoenix the immortal ?

Troubling eyes, go out of my way for ever !
Back to me indifference dreary come now !
That I my in quietness die, O give me
Back my old selfhood !

Translated by Petre Grimm
